Hi Nicolas

On our website we currently use clean SEF URLs (no IDs in the path). We would like to display the full breadcrumb on product pages (Home > category > subcategory > product), but we understand that in HikaShop this may require adding a parameter/identifier to the product URL (related to the category/path), or even changing the URL format.

Before changing anything, we need to confirm the following:

Is there a way to show full breadcrumbs without changing our current SEF URL format?

Specifically: keep the friendly URL path exactly as it is, and if needed, let HikaShop resolve the breadcrumb internally.

Regarding the “Simplified breadcrumbs” option:

If we disable it to get full breadcrumbs, what exactly changes in the URLs? (does it add a category/path parameter?)

Can it generate multiple URLs for the same product (one per category)? If so, what is your official recommendation to avoid duplication issues (canonical URLs, “Force canonical URLs on listings”, etc.)?

Worst case, if there is no alternative and this requires changing URLs sitewide (both categories and products):

Does HikaShop provide any tool or recommended method to manage 301 redirects in bulk (export/import old URL → new URL mapping, integration with Joomla’s Redirect component, a plugin, etc.)?

We are concerned about doing this manually in .htaccess due to the volume. Is there a “simple and safe” approach you recommend (for example, a redirect mapping/table system) that avoids thousands of .htaccess rules?

Our goal is: full breadcrumbs + one canonical URL per product + zero SEO loss (no duplication, no unnecessary migrations).
